20 year old Mortlach, independently bottled by Duncan Taylor as part of their excellent Octave range. This was distilled in 1997 and bottled in 2017 after spending 8 months in a tiny octave cask. Only 74 bottles were produced.
Nose: Roasted peanuts and meaty malt, joined by chocolate shop aromas.
Palate: An intense whack of cinnamon and black pepper, tempered slightly by cookie dough and spun sugar.
Finish: Drying spices, more meaty malt.
